As for Iran, it has been not only Israel’s but the USA’s long-held target for regime change, one way or another, in order to remove the only real bulwark against total Zionazi control of the Middle East.

FFS, it was all spelled out in 1997 by the Neo-Cons: “What should the U.S. role be? Benevolent global hegemony. Having defeated the ‘evil empire,’ the United States enjoys strategic and ideological predominance. The first objective of U.S. foreign policy should be to preserve and enhance that predominance by strengthening America’s security, supporting its friends, advancing its interests, and standing up for its principles around the world.”

Sure, the Project for the New American Century (PNAC) was more of less dissolved in the mid-2000s but its core aim of “full spectrum dominance” remains deeply entrenched in US foreign policy.

According to the Council on Foreign Relations, the US maintains a vast network of military sites surrounding Iran. Eight of these direct threats are permanent bases, located in Bahrain, Egypt, Iraq, Jordan, Kuwait, Qatar, Saudi Arabia, and the United Arab Emirates, and there are at least 60,000 US troops deployed throughout the region.
